After only 25 points in their last matchup, Lone Star made sure to put some points up on the board against Heritage on Saturday. The Lone Star Rangers strolled past the Heritage Coyotes with points to spare, taking the game 56-37. That result was just more of the same for these two, as the Rangers also won the last time the pair played back in January of 2022.
Despite the defeat, Heritage had strong showings from Danielle Henry, who went 5 for 8 en route to 12 points, and Jadyn Middleton, who had 16 points. That was a full 43.2% of Heritage's points, marking the sixth time in a row she's posted more than a third of the team's points.
Lone Star's win bumped their record up to 2-4. As for Heritage,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 3-3.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Lone Star will welcome Prosper at 6: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Lone Star will be looking to keep their five-game home win streak dating back to last season alive. As for Heritage, they will host Walnut Grove at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
